This is a superb tiny camera with alot of enjoyable characteristics. I had a challenging time deciding in between the s8100 and the s6100 because the s8100 takes more rapidly pictures, 1080 video, a far better sensor, and bigger zoom.The characteristics listed below are the reasons I chose the s6100.
Touch screen--can use your finger but it can be a tiny tricky to move it just ideal. It does come with a stylus that makes it possible for you to move through the screens quickly. Makes it extremely simple to get by way of the menus. The menu on the left has the choices for flash, self-timer, macro, and exposure compensation. The menu on the bottom has the selections for touch shutter, image mode, movie options, and settings. The battery levels are at all times displayed in the left hand corner so there is no guessing how much battery is left. Above that the scene mode is displayed.
Scene choice--There are 19 scenes to pick out from plus the scene auto selector. When you push the scene button and all 20 options are listed there is a question mark box in the upper correct hand corner that will clarify the different modes to assist you select the proper a single.
Filter Effects--It has the capacity to draw or write on photographs, add decorations, cross screen, fish eye, selective color, black and white, sepia. I have messed around with a handful of of these attributes, I will attempt to upload a couple of pictures. It also has glamour retouch and skin softening.
Playback button--Has options to star a photo as preferred, delete, slide show, protect, print, draw, retouch, voice record, and settings.
Charger--This camera can charge through your computer system or it also has an adapter substantially like most cell phones now do so you can use the USB cord to charge employing an outlet. There is a light on the back that flashes to let you know it is charging.
The devoted movie button makes it really straightforward to record videos. In contrast to the 8100, you cannot take a photo whilst you are recording with the 6100.
From the opinion of a hobby photographer, I assume there are alot of capabilities nicely packaged into this pocket-sized camera.
I've owned this camera for three-months and waited until now to write a critique because it was a gift and I really wanted to like this camera. But the additional I've applied it the less I like it. To be fair, it can take a descent picture below optimal circumstances if you are cautious, but so can a 1968 Kodak Brownie in the correct hands. I honestly expected far more from Nikon and modern electronic technology.
Let me give you a tiny a lot more background... I am 63 years old and I've been taking images due to the fact I was 8 years old. Last winter I suffered a stroke which affected the coordination in my left hand and I identified it difficuly to operate my Nikon D50 SLR. My wife, trying to be good to me bought an S6100 for my birthday considering she assumed that a point-and-shoot would be easier and less frustrating for me to use than my D50 SLR. I was excited to get it and try it out. The Nikon S6100 was smaller, lighter and less difficult to carry. As far as becoming less difficult to use,
it is NOT! A person would anticipate an automatic point-and-shoot camera to be just that, point it, press the shutter release and get a fair image most of the time. That's a thing this camera can't do with any regularity. A pox on Nikons residence for the damn touch screen controls! Why have a touch screen shutter release function that duplicates the function of the shutter release button? Though you attempt to hold the camera with your appropriate hand you are pretty much forced to touch the screen though trying to frame the image and push the "real button". This a great deal more frequently than not activates the shutter resulting in a image of the ground, your pant leg, or shoe. Then whilst you wait for the exceedingly slow electronics to retailer that image on the memory card, you miss a few oportunities to attempt for a beneficial shot. Would that this was the only situation with the touch screen. Nikon designed this cameras controls so the ONLY way to manage many camera functions is via a menu program controlled utilizing the touch screen. If that were not negative sufficient the screen itself is not sensitive sufficient to respond nicely to a finger touch unless you use a extended finger nail or the tiny stylus hung on the wrist strap. This virtually insures that you can't make any sort of quick option modifications when you try to shoot. You may perhaps wonder if that screen does something else. Yes, it shows a fairly bright image to use as a viewfinder or to critique pictures of your shoes taken by mistake. Of course it is constantly smugged and dirty for the reason that you have to be touching it all the time.
How about the overall function? The S6100 is as functional as most of it is competitors in the crowded point-and-shoot field. It is a snapshot camera at ideal loaded with hard to manage capabilities and totally unecessary post shooting editing functions that are significantly improved done on your laptop or computer following you download the images. I expected far better from Nikon and I undoubtedly thought that a 16 megapixel sensor would capture much better high quality shots. Once again I was disappointed. My 6 megapixel D50 captures greater images and it really is more than 5-years old. In anything other than optimal light, the automatic functions of the S6100 bump up the ISO a couple of clicks and as soon as that's happened the image swiftly gets grainy with out gaining great exposure. Once more I confident expected improved from the newer class of sensors and computer software. The S6100 can also take Quicktime films with a single press of the movie button on the back. This would be a good function if the film button had been not modest placed directly below the proper side thumb grip, almost ensuring that you will take some short movies you didn't want, once again often of the ground, your shoe, or the sky.
Oh, and then there is battery life. Not too fine. I can get perhaps 200 shots and a short film just before the "battery exhausted" message pops up on the screen, and then you are done because the only way to recharge it is to plug the whole camera into the charger or a personal computer USB port, you will be out of luck in the field unless you invest in a second battery, keep it charged and in your pocket when you'r out shooting.
Do you believe I've been be too unfavorable about the S6100?
Right here are the very good factors about it:
1. It really is tiny, light, and fits readily in a shirt pocket or purse
2. The zoom lens is Nikon, and they do make the preferred optics and the wide to full zoom is all you will likely ever will need.
three. When you manage to get a snap shot it is normally of sufficient quality, at least for your loved ones album.
MY RECOMMEDATIONS:
If you want a point-and shoot Nikon, check out the S8100 or S9100, both a lot far better cameras at only a slightly greater value.
If you want awesome images and care about control of your camera functions get a Digital SLR and understand how to use it.
If you want a touch screen get a intelligent phone. Most of those will take pictures and films too, and might possibly be much easier to use than this camera, plus when you get frustrated with the smugged up touch screen, at least you can use it to call somebody who cares.
